Bichon
A Bichon Frise is a small, cheerful, and affectionate breed known for its fluffy white coat and playful personality. These dogs are friendly, social, and love being around people, making them great family pets. With their soft, curly fur and bright, expressive eyes, Bichons are as charming as they are cuddly. They’re also intelligent and eager to please, which makes training easy—plus, they’re hypoallergenic, making them a great choice for allergy sufferers.
French Bulldogs
The French Bulldog has enjoyed a long history as a companion dog. Created in England to be a miniature Bulldog, he accompanied English lacemakers to France, where he acquired his Frenchie moniker. Besides being a companion, he once served as an excellent ratter, but today his job focuses on being a fabulous family friend and show dog.
Golden Retriever
Golden Retrievers are friendly, intelligent, and loyal dogs known for their beautiful golden coats and gentle nature. They’re eager to please, great with families, and love both playtime and cuddles. Their outgoing personality and trainability make them excellent companions and service dogs.

Pug-Poo's
A Pug-Poo (also called a Pugapoo) is a crossbreed between a Pug and a Poodle. These little dogs are typically small, playful, and full of personality. They often combine the Pug’s affectionate, clownish charm with the Poodle’s intelligence and low-shedding coat. Because of their mixed heritage, their appearance can vary—some have a shorter snout like a Pug, while others have a curlier coat like a Poodle. Pug-Poos are usually loyal, people-loving companions who do best with families that can give them plenty of attention and playtime.
